Event Description
Will Arnett plays a rookie stand-up comic, freshly divorced, in this warm, bittersweet comedy.
As their marriage quietly unravels, Alex dips into the New York comedy scene while Tess confronts the sacrifices she made for their family. The split is largely amicable, but stresses and strains persist around co parenting, identity shifts – and whether old love can take new form. Originating in the real-life experience of British comedian John Bishop and co-written by Arnett (Arrested Development) and Cooper (A Star is Born, Maestro), this is a real charmer of a picture, loose and funny, about the vicissitudes of middle age.
DIRECTOR: Bradley Cooper
STARRING: Will Arnett, Laura Dern, Andra Day, Bradley Cooper, Amy Sedaris
US, 2025
2 HOURS 4 MINUTES
ENGLISH
